Finding the Right Panasonic TV Remote
Losing your Panasonic TV remote can be a real pain. Luckily, finding the right replacement is usually pretty easy. The first step is to figure out your specific model. This information is often printed on the back of your TV or in its instruction booklet. Once you have that, you can browse online or visit a department store to find a compatible remote.
Be sure to review the product specifications carefully before making a purchase to ensure it's the right fit for your TV model. You can also contact Panasonic customer service if you have any questions or need assistance.

All-Purpose vs. Proprietary TV Remotes: A Comparison
When it comes to controlling your television, you have a choice: opt for a universal remote or stick with a click here brand-specific one. Each type has its own benefits, as well as drawbacks.
Universal remotes offer the convenience of controlling multiple devices with a single gadget. This can be particularly helpful if you have a variety of electronics, like a TV, DVD player, and sound bar. On the other hand, brand-specific remotes are often designed to work seamlessly with their corresponding devices, providing a more user-friendly experience. They may also offer custom features specific to that brand.
- Universal remotes often have a more pronounced learning curve as you need to program them for each device.
- Brand-specific remotes typically provide a more streamlined experience for controlling the specific brand of television.
Ultimately, the best choice depends on your individual needs and preferences.
Fixing Common TV Remote Issues
Is your TV remote giving you a hard time? Don't worry, you're not alone! Remote problems are common. Luckily, there are some easy things you can try to ensure it working again. First, check the batteries. Make sure they're fresh and installed correctly. Sometimes, simply cleaning the remote with a damp cloth can fix the issue. If that doesn't work, try syncing the remote to your TV again by following the instructions in your user manual. Still having trouble? You may need to replace the remote altogether.
Here are some further tips:
* Make sure there are no things blocking the signal between the remote and the TV.
* Try pointing the remote directly at the TV's sensor.
* Check for any updates available for your TV's firmware.
